HAIFA, Israel, January 6, 2019 /PRNewswire/ --
Elbit Systems Ltd. (NASDAQ:
ESLT) (TASE: ESLT) ("Elbit Systems" or "the Company")
announced today that following the closing of the transaction for
the acquisition of IMI Systems Ltd. by the Company, Midroog Ltd.,
an Israeli rating agency ("Midroog"), issued its monitoring report
regarding the Series "A" Notes issued by the Company in 2010 and in
2012 (the "Notes") and reaffirmed the Notes' "Aa1.il" (on a local
scale) rating, while changing the rating outlook to negative.
Midroog's official monitoring report in Hebrew will be submitted
to the Israel Securities Authority and the TASE. An unofficial
English translation of Midroog's monitoring report will be
submitted by the Company on Form 6-K to the U.S. Securities and
Exchange Commission.

About Elbit Systems
Elbit Systems Ltd. is an international high technology company
engaged in a wide range of defense, homeland security and
commercial programs throughout the world. The Company, which
includes Elbit Systems and its subsidiaries, operates in the areas
of aerospace, land and naval systems, command, control,
communications, computers, intelligence surveillance and
reconnaissance ("C4ISR"), unmanned aircraft systems, advanced
electro-optics, electro-optic space systems, EW suites, signal
intelligence systems, data links and communications systems, radios
and cyber-based systems. The Company also focuses on the
upgrading of existing platforms, developing new technologies for
defense, homeland security and commercial applications and
providing a range of support services, including training and
simulation systems.
